Patent Searching and Data


Title:
QUANTUM DEVICE, METHOD FOR CONTROLLING SUCH QUANTUM DEVICE AND METHOD FOR MANUFACTURING SUCH QUANTUM DEVICE
Document Type and Number:
WIPO Patent Application WO/2006/097976
Kind Code:
A1
Abstract:
A quantum dot (22) is formed on a GaAs substrate (20). In the quantum dot (22), a single electron exists. A cap layer (26) is formed on a circumference of the quantum dot (22), and a barrier layer (28) is formed on the cap layer. A quantum dot (30) for detection is formed on the barrier layer (28). Then, a cap layer (34) is formed to cover the quantum dot (30) and the like.
